Karl Eberts wrote:
> 
> I REALLY need help, I have written a small program to start out (note:
> this is my FIRST program on djgpp) and whenever I try to compile it;
> typing "gcc -o hello.exe hello.c" I get an error message that says
> "hello.c:3: sdio.h: No such file or directory (ENOENT)" What does this
> mean and how do I fix it? --  AIH

That's stdio.h!
         ^

Check your spelling.
